org.apache.hivemind.annotations
Class AnnotationsMessages

java.lang.Object
  extended by org.apache.hivemind.annotations.AnnotationsMessages

public class AnnotationsMessages
extends java.lang.Object

Used to format messages used in errors and log output for classes within the impl package.

Author:
Achim Huegen

Constructor Summary
AnnotationsMessages()
           
 
Method Summary
static java.lang.String annotatedMethodHasInvalidModifiers(java.lang.reflect.Method method, java.lang.String methodType, int invalidModifiers)
           
static java.lang.String annotatedMethodIsProtectedAndNotAccessible(java.lang.reflect.Method method, java.lang.String methodType)
           
static java.lang.String moduleClassHasInvalidModifiers(java.lang.Class moduleClass, int invalidModifiers)
           
static java.lang.String moduleClassIsPackagePrivate(java.lang.Class moduleClass)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

AnnotationsMessages

public AnnotationsMessages()
Method Detail

moduleClassHasInvalidModifiers

public static java.lang.String moduleClassHasInvalidModifiers(java.lang.Class moduleClass,
                                                              int invalidModifiers)

moduleClassIsPackagePrivate

public static java.lang.String moduleClassIsPackagePrivate(java.lang.Class moduleClass)

annotatedMethodHasInvalidModifiers

public static java.lang.String annotatedMethodHasInvalidModifiers(java.lang.reflect.Method method,
                                                                  java.lang.String methodType,
                                                                  int invalidModifiers)

annotatedMethodIsProtectedAndNotAccessible

public static java.lang.String annotatedMethodIsProtectedAndNotAccessible(java.lang.reflect.Method method,
                                                                          java.lang.String methodType)


Copyright © 2006-2007 Apache Software Foundation. All Rights Reserved.